Julia Simic, a TV expert and former national player, offered her analysis on the volatile coaching situation at Eintracht Frankfurt. Speaking to the portal “Absolut Fussball” from Ippen-Media, she suggested that the outgoing coach, Albert Riera, lacked the necessary support from both the fans and the squad. Simic commented that when doubts about the team becoming “a circus” arise just one or two weeks into the season, the observers themselves contribute to that perception.
Having been part of the club until the winter period, Simic now assesses Riera’s appointment as a failure. While the club desired a more assertive and dominating coach following the Toppmöller era, those expectations were ultimately unmet.
On a more positive note, Simic cited VfB Stuttgart under Sebastian Hoeneß as an example of successful management, pointing out that the team maintained continuity despite numerous departures and successfully qualified for international competition once again. Conversely, she labeled VfL Wolfsburg’s relegation as the biggest surprise of the season, arguing that the team’s individual talent level should have been sufficient to avoid dropping into the lower division.
